  1. I've just got a new Merida Scultura frame for a really good price. It's from the 7000e. They're normally built with Di2 Ultegra.

    I want to build it up to sell for a profit - using some of the gear I already have.

    I have a used pair of 105 11 speed shifters that I got cheap. Looking on Wiggle(and possibly one or two used bits) the rest of the 105 running gear is reasonably priced so I could build it up as 11 speed.
    There may be more interest in the bike been 11 speed and it may be more in keeping with the frame.

    In my boxes of bits I have a 5700 (105) groupset already so I could build it up as 10 speed. That would be nice as I'd get rid of some gear and it would still be a nice groupset for someone on what would be a cheaper bike all up.

    What to do?
